Workers' Acceptability of a Prototype Integrated and Interactive Pedal Desk
In Brief
A clinical study evaluating WAPD for Acceptability of Semi-recumbent Pedal Desk. Completed, enrolled 44 participants across 1 site.
Detailed Summary
The purpose of this study is to assess full-time workers'impressions and acceptability of a prototype pedal desk. The pedal-desk is a semi-recumbent (upright) portable pedal mechanism that allows workers to complete tasks in a traditional seated position.
